Transaction 39ab922c01aeb071232ee0e0f7c558233f6e6cf3d65cf0b146ae18b1ee52fac3
1 Input
1 Output
-
39ab922c01aeb071232ee0e0f7c558233f6e6cf3d65cf0b146ae18b1ee52fac3:0
- value
- 18529627
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 09ad6eb265ed12381fcf1c3eb23e4cd1c80f4526 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1tAr2FVwRWyYrn8R5dtSeMg4ywZhFx7dL